Guest User

Untitled

a guest
May 23rd, 2018
76
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.58 KB | None | 0 0
  1. #!/bin/bash
  2. # Convert anything mplayer can play to low quality MP3
  3.  
  4. IFS="
  5. "
  6.  
  7. for file in $*; do
  8. if [[ -f "$file" ]];
  9. then
  10. filename=$(basename "$file")
  11. extension=${filename##*.}
  12. filename=${filename%.*}
  13. filenoext=${file%.*}
  14. wav="$filenoext.wav"
  15. mp3="$filenoext.mp3"
  16. echo "Converting ${filename}.${extension} to MP3"
  17. mplayer -vo null -vc null -af resample=44100 -ao pcm:waveheader "$file"
  18. lame -V6 -h audiodump.wav "$mp3"
  19. rm audiodump.wav
  20. else
  21. echo "File $file doesn't appear to exist."
  22. fi
  23. done
Add Comment
Please, Sign In to add comment